Bangladesh’s creative industry celebrates a proud milestone as Mohammad Akrum Hossain, Chief Creative Officer of POP 5 Ltd., is appointed as a Grand Juror for the “Direct, Outdoor” category at Spikes Asia 2026. His selection for one of the region’s most prestigious creative festivals highlights not only his personal achievements but also Bangladesh’s expanding presence in the global advertising landscape. This recognition reinforces the country’s growing contribution to innovative, impactful creative work across Asia-Pacific.
Akrum’s illustrious career is defined by purpose-driven creativity and award-winning work that resonates across cultures. Over the years, he has represented Bangladesh on some of the world’s most respected international juries, including Cannes Lions, AdFest, Effie Awards APAC, MAD STARS, LIA Coach, US International Festival, Creative Circle UK, PHNX, Indie Awards, The One Show, and more. His consistent participation in global platforms reflects his deep understanding of creativity and his commitment to elevating the standards of the industry.
His recent appointment extends Bangladesh’s growing influence in international creative forums, following his involvement with the esteemed Citra Pariwara Festival—one of Indonesia’s most respected celebrations of advertising, design, and communication excellence.
